更多>>PHP程序设计 Blog
来源:一度好 时间:2018-11-28 阅读:3226
在Windows下的PHP环境中,想要安装memcache,需要注意的事项,如何选择正确的版本。
1、在你的php环境部署完成后,接下来就要考虑安装memcache了。
2、获取php相应的配置信息,用以选择下载相应的memcache版本。
在 phpinfo(); 的返回信息中:
(1)获取php的版本号:PHP Version 5.6.27,说明是php5.6版本
(2)判断是x86环境还是x64环境
Architecture: x86 ,说明你需要下载x86环境的。
特别说明:这与你电脑的操作系统没有关系,即使你的电脑显示的是64位操作系统,如果Architecture的值是x86,你也只能下载x86,而不能下载x64的,切记。
(3)判断VC的版本号
Compiler: MSVC11 (Visual C++ 2012) ,说明你需要下载VC11版本的。
(4)判断是ts还是nts
Thread Safety: disabled ,说明你需要下载nts版本的,如果值为 enabled,则需要下载ts版本的。
备注:Thread Safe(线程安全)版本,None Thread Safe(非线程安全)版本。
相应的也可根据下面2项值来进行判断:
Zend Extension Build: API220131226,NTS,VC11
PHP Extension Build: API20131226,NTS,VC11
说明需要下载nts-vc11版本的。
总结:根据返回的结果,你需要下载对应的版本为:5.6-nts-vc11-x86
3、在php.net官网上,下载memcache
(1)打开如下的网址:https://windows.php.net/downloads/pecl/releases
(2)找到memcache,点击进去,会出现版本号页面,再点击进去
(3)根据第2步总结的结果,下载对应的版本
即:php_memcache-3.0.8-5.6-nts-vc11-x86.zip
4、安装memcache
把下载包解压到本地后,把php_memcache.dll文件,复制到php对应的版本下的 ext 目录中,如:php-5.6.27-nts\ext下
然后,在 php.ini上增加一行:
extension=php_memcache.dll
5、重启服务器,安装完成
6、检测安装结果
在phpinfo();页面,搜索memcache,即可看到memcache已经启用了。
评论列表 |
暂时没有相关记录
|
发表评论